I'm trying to remember what I heard about VS content now, it wasn't exactly that it would rank better. It was more along the lines of creating content aimed at people that are further along the purchasing life cycle. Someone that is searching for information comparing one product with another product often means the person is nearly ready to buy. I also heard it is often that they will be buying one or the other no matter what happens so if you have an affiliate marketing website and you are affiliated with both products you are comparing chances are you will make a sale from one of those items.

I think that is what I read, it was a while back though.
